diff options
author | Kyrylo Tkachov <kyrylo.tkachov@arm.com> | 2014-09-09 11:27:49 +0000 |
---|---|---|
committer | Kyrylo Tkachov <ktkachov@gcc.gnu.org> | 2014-09-09 11:27:49 +0000 |
commit | 5a1501087f3479efe896c0a608e4705d0d3334ec (patch) | |
tree | 05028650f80c103055e9223f66d5148db4efa493 /gcc | |
parent | c278658453f6cc135ff0cc94368752f4402d11a6 (diff) | |
download | gcc-5a1501087f3479efe896c0a608e4705d0d3334ec.zip gcc-5a1501087f3479efe896c0a608e4705d0d3334ec.tar.gz gcc-5a1501087f3479efe896c0a608e4705d0d3334ec.tar.bz2 |
[ARM][6/7] Convert FP mnemonics to UAL | movcc_vfp (fmstat)
* config/arm/vfp.md (*movcc_vfp): Use UAL syntax.
From-SVN: r215055
Diffstat (limited to 'gcc')
-rw-r--r-- | gcc/ChangeLog | 4 | ||||
-rw-r--r-- | gcc/config/arm/vfp.md | 2 |
2 files changed, 5 insertions, 1 deletions
diff --git a/gcc/ChangeLog b/gcc/ChangeLog index a2fe548..75c1dd3 100644 --- a/gcc/ChangeLog +++ b/gcc/ChangeLog @@ -1,5 +1,9 @@ 2014-09-09 Kyrylo Tkachov <kyrylo.tkachov@arm.com> + * config/arm/vfp.md (*movcc_vfp): Use UAL syntax. + +2014-09-09 Kyrylo Tkachov <kyrylo.tkachov@arm.com> + * config/arm/vfp.md (*sqrtsf2_vfp): Use UAL assembly syntax. (*sqrtdf2_vfp): Likewise. (*cmpsf_vfp): Likewise. diff --git a/gcc/config/arm/vfp.md b/gcc/config/arm/vfp.md index d23f7c9..06c057f 100644 --- a/gcc/config/arm/vfp.md +++ b/gcc/config/arm/vfp.md @@ -1107,7 +1107,7 @@ [(set (reg CC_REGNUM) (reg VFPCC_REGNUM))] "TARGET_32BIT && TARGET_HARD_FLOAT && TARGET_VFP" - "fmstat%?" + "vmrs%?\\tAPSR_nzcv, FPSCR" [(set_attr "conds" "set") (set_attr "type" "f_flag")] ) |